Built In Cabinetry Staining in Muncie, IN
Built-in cabinetry staining services focus on enhancing the appearance and durability of existing built-in storage solutions such as bookshelves, kitchen cabinets, and custom wall units. This process involves applying a stain to change or enrich the color of the wood, highlighting its natural grain and texture. Property owners often request this service to update the look of their interiors, restore faded finishes, or achieve a specific color tone that complements their décor. It’s a popular choice for those seeking a refreshed, polished appearance without replacing existing cabinetry.
Before requesting built-in cabinetry staining, property owners should consider the current condition of the wood surfaces, including any existing finishes, scratches, or damage that may affect the staining process. It’s also helpful to understand the desired color outcome and whether a transparent, semi-transparent, or opaque stain is preferred. Proper preparation, such as cleaning and sanding the surfaces, is essential for achieving a smooth, even finish. Consulting with a professional can provide guidance on the best stain types and application techniques to meet aesthetic goals and ensure lasting results.

Built In Cabinetry Staining Questions
What types of cabinetry are suitable for staining? Built-in cabinets made of solid wood or veneer are ideal for staining to enhance their natural appearance.
Can staining change the color of existing built-in cabinetry? Yes, staining can alter the color and highlight the wood grain, providing a refreshed look.
Is staining a good option for cabinets with existing paint or finish? Staining is best suited for bare or unfinished wood; painted surfaces typically require stripping before staining.
What should homeowners consider before staining built-in cabinetry? It's important to evaluate the wood type, current finish, and desired color to ensure a quality result.
